目的:用实时荧光定量聚合酶链反应(FQ-PCR)技术准确定量检测尖锐湿疣中的人类乳头瘤病毒含量并分析其类型,为临床治疗提供依据。方法:采用实时FQ-PCR技术,检测了临床送检标本48份。结果:检测出人类乳头瘤病毒6,11型42例,人类乳头瘤病毒16,18型2例。结论:人类乳头瘤病毒6,11型是尖锐湿疣主要感染源。
Objective: To detect the content of human papillomavirus in condyloma acuminata accurately and quantitatively by real-time fluorescence quantitative polymerase chain reaction (FQ-PCR) technique, and to provide the basis for clinical treatment. Methods: Real-time FQ-PCR was used to detect 48 clinical specimens. Results: 42 cases of human papilloma virus type 6 and 11 and 2 cases of human papillomavirus type 16 and 18 were detected. Conclusion: Human papillomavirus types 6 and 11 are the main source of genital warts.
